public abstract class ColumnGroupPartitioner extends Object
Constructor and Description |
---|
ColumnGroupPartitioner() |
Modifier and Type | Method and Description |
---|---|
abstract List<int[]> |
partitionColumns(List<Integer> groupCols,
HashMap<Integer,PlanningCoCoder.GroupableColInfo> groupColsInfo,
CompressionSettings cs)
Partitions a list of columns into a list of partitions that contains subsets of columns.
|
public abstract List<int[]> partitionColumns(List<Integer> groupCols, HashMap<Integer,PlanningCoCoder.GroupableColInfo> groupColsInfo, CompressionSettings cs)
groupCols
- list of columnsgroupColsInfo
- list of column infoscs
- The Compression settings used for the compressionCopyright © 2020 The Apache Software Foundation. All rights reserved.